唾液睾酮的直接放射免疫分析(RIA):与血清游离睾酮和总睾酮的相关性

Direct radioimmunoassay (RIA) of salivary testosterone: correlation with free and total serum testosterone.

作者信息

Vittek J, L'Hommedieu D G, Gordon G G, Rappaport S C, Southren A L

出版信息

Life Sci. 1985 Aug 26;37(8):711-6. doi: 10.1016/0024-3205(85)90540-5.

DOI:10.1016/0024-3205(85)90540-5
PMID:4021735
Abstract

Simple and sensitive direct RIA for determination of salivary testosterone was developed by using RSL NOSOLVEX TM (125 1) kit produced by Radioassay System Laboratories (Carson, California). In addition, a relationship between salivary and serum free and total testosterone concentrations was studied in randomly selected 45 healthy subjects, 5 females on oral contraceptive pills and 28 hypertensive patients on various treatment regimens. The lowest weight of testosterone detectable by our modified method was equivalent to 1 pg/ml of saliva, taking into account analytical variability. Intra- and interassay coefficients of variation were 5.09 +/- 2.7% and 8.2 +/- 5.9% respectively. Statistically significant correlations were found between salivary and serum free testosterone (r = 0.97) and salivary and serum total testosterone concentrations (r = 0.70-0.87). The exception to this was a group of hypertensive females in which no correlation (r = 0.14) between salivary and total serum testosterone was found. It is also of interest that, while salivary testosterone was significantly increased in subjects taking oral contraceptives and most of the hypertensive patients the total serum testosterone concentration was in normal range. Our findings suggest that determination of salivary testosterone is a reliable method to detect changes in the concentration of available biologically active hormone in the circulation.

摘要

利用放射免疫分析系统实验室(加利福尼亚州卡森市)生产的RSL NOSOLVEX TM(125 I)试剂盒,开发了一种简单且灵敏的直接放射免疫分析法,用于测定唾液睾酮。此外,还对45名随机选取的健康受试者、5名服用口服避孕药的女性以及28名接受各种治疗方案的高血压患者的唾液和血清中游离睾酮及总睾酮浓度之间的关系进行了研究。考虑到分析变异性,我们改进后的方法可检测到的最低睾酮重量相当于唾液中1 pg/ml。批内和批间变异系数分别为5.09±2.7%和8.2±5.9%。在唾液和血清游离睾酮(r = 0.97)以及唾液和血清总睾酮浓度(r = 0.70 - 0.87)之间发现了具有统计学意义的相关性。唯一的例外是一组高血压女性,在她们的唾液和血清总睾酮之间未发现相关性(r = 0.14)。同样有趣的是,虽然服用口服避孕药的受试者和大多数高血压患者的唾液睾酮显著升高,但血清总睾酮浓度却在正常范围内。我们的研究结果表明,测定唾液睾酮是检测循环中可用生物活性激素浓度变化的可靠方法。
